How they compare

Hungary currently reports 1,535 affected per 100,000 people against 1,495 affected per 100,000 people in Kyrgyzstan, a difference of 40 affected per 100,000 people.

The two have swapped places 4 times across 8 shared years of data; in 2002 it was Kyrgyzstan ahead.

Hungary ranks 45th and Kyrgyzstan ranks 46th of 167 countries.

Kyrgyzstan has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
